Insecurity: Niger Gov Directs Security Agents To Arrest Anybody With Dreadlock Hair

Governor Umaru Mohammed Bago of Niger State has directed security agencies to arrest individuals found with dreadlocks or firearms across the state.
The governor, who gave the directive at a security stakeholders’ meeting in Minna, the state capital, said: “anybody that you find with dreadlock, arrest him, barb his hair and fine him.
“Nobody should carry any kind of haircut again inside here. I have given you marching order, the security agencies, any boy, anybody you find with a weapon, deal with him as an armed robber.”
To parents, the governor said: “So warn your children, warn your wards.”
The meeting was attended by traditional rulers, law enforcement officials, and community leaders. The meeting held in response to a recent surge in violence and criminal activity.
